Q: What are the dimension and load capacity specifications for RA 632-057-101?
A: RA 632-057-101 specifications differ from the 057-008 series. Confirm the wheel diameter, width, bore size, and maximum load rating match your equipment before ordering. Incorrect wheel sizes cause alignment problems, premature bearing failure, and equipment instability.

Q: Can I use RA 632-057-101 wheels to replace RA 632-057-008 wheels?
A: No. Different part numbers indicate different wheel specifications. Substituting incompatible wheel sizes or load ratings will compromise equipment performance and safety. Always replace with the exact OEM part number specified for your equipment.

Q: What is the expected service life of the RA 632-057-101 wheel?
A: Typical service life is 1 to 3 years depending on usage hours, load weight, floor conditions, and operating environment. More intensive use or harsh conditions reduce lifespan. Inspect wheels regularly for wear and replace when damage occurs to maintain equipment performance and safety.
